Ensequence, Sony Reach Connected TV Deal
Dec 4, 2012 – Ensequence and Sony have reached a multi-year deal to embed Ensequence's platform software on all Sony Connected TVs. The collaboration offers advertisers and programmers a way to engage viewers directly with TV ads and shows.

Ensequence Announces Interactive TV Partnerships With Softel, S & T and VDS
May 10, 2010 – Ensequence has entered into partnerships with interactive application streamer provider Softel, streamer provider S & T and broadcast automation vendor VDS to provide a single-source interactive TV platform for TV service providers and programmers.

CableLab® Announces Next in Series of Interactive and Advanced Advertising Specifications
Jul 1, 2009 – CableLabs® has announced the issuance of a new set of specifications called the Stewardship and Fulfillment Interfaces (SaFI), created to further the development of cable advertising and other interactive products.

Zodiac Interactive Announces EBIF Players for Tru2way™ and PowerTV
Dec 16, 2008 – Zodiac Interactive has announced the release of an ETV/EBIF™ (Enhanced TV Binary Interchange Format) player for PowerTV and the tru2way™.
